Electrical Engineer
Canvas Eglin Air Force Base, FL
Key Responsibilities: Design & Project Development: Develop comprehensive engineering designs, statements of work, specifications, and cost estimates for facility electrical systems, including interior/exterior lighting, power distribution, backup generators, and fire alarm systems. Infrastructure Assessment: Conduct site visits and field investigations to evaluate existing medium and low-voltage electrical distribution systems, transformers, switchgear, and airfield lighting. Identify infrastructure deficiencies and recommend lifecycle upgrades or critical repairs. Contract & Construction Oversight: Review technical submittals, shop drawings, and project plans provided by construction contractors. Ensure all proposed work strictly complies with the National Electrical Code (NEC), Unified Facilities Criteria (UFC), and Department of the Air Force standards. Mechanical Engineer
Canvas Eglin Air Force Base, FL
Key Responsibilities: Design & Project Development: Develop comprehensive engineering designs, scopes of work, specifications, and cost estimates for facility mechanical systems, including advanced HVAC, refrigeration, plumbing, fire suppression, and building automation control systems. Infrastructure Assessment: Conduct site investigations and energy audits to evaluate existing mechanical systems, boilers, chillers, and distribution piping. Identify deficiencies, calculate thermal loads, and recommend lifecycle upgrades or energy-efficient modernization strategies. Contract & Construction Oversight: Review technical submittals, equipment shop drawings, and design plans submitted by external construction contractors. Ensure all proposed work complies with the International Mechanical Code (IMC), Unified Facilities Criteria (UFC), and Department of the Air Force standards.
